Denis Wick launches UK Young Ambassador Programme

In collaboration with the company's marketing team, Denis Wick Products and its UK Young Ambassador Programme is aimed to help develop four young players from the Manchester area. They will be mentored and coached by existing artists and will see them involved in product demonstrations and product development. The young musicians will also collaborate with leading Denis Wick and Alliance artists to work on their quartet and solo talents as well as developing their tutoring skills. The group will work alongside Sheona Wade, Richard Marshall and Matthew Routley.

The initiative began at the request of the four young players: Alice Clarke, who plays solo horn with Wingates Band, Ben Burke a Bb bass player with Blackburn & Darwen and the 2nd Rossendale Scout Band, Oliver Tattersall who plays cornet with Whitworth Vale & Healey, and Oliver Atherton, who plays for Milnrow Band and is studying at the Royal Northern College of Music.

Denis Wick Market Lead, Dr Brett Baker, was immediately taken with the idea and has been integral in setting the wheels in motion. Commenting on the initiative Brett stated, "This is the type of proactive involvement in the banding movement that is essential for it to attract new players and new leaders. This is very much a pilot scheme at present, but we are keen to see it succeed and are equally passionate about its ambitions as the players themselves."
